Merge branch 'linus' into x86/cleanups
[deliverable/linux.git] / drivers / net / wireless / realtek / rtlwifi / Kconfig
CommitLineData
6f334c2b
LF
1menuconfig RTL_CARDS
2 tristate "Realtek rtlwifi family of devices"
3 depends on MAC80211 && (PCI || USB)
06e7cda3
LF
4 default y
5 ---help---
6f334c2b
LF
6 This option will enable support for the Realtek mac80211-based
7 wireless drivers. Drivers rtl8192ce, rtl8192cu, rtl8192se, rtl8192de,
b1a3bfc9
LF
8 rtl8723ae, rtl8723be, rtl8188ee, rtl8192ee, and rtl8821ae share
9 some common code.
6f334c2b
LF
10
11if RTL_CARDS
06e7cda3 12
0c817338 13config RTL8192CE
663dcc73 14 tristate "Realtek RTL8192CE/RTL8188CE Wireless Network Adapter"
6f334c2b 15 depends on PCI
1472d3a8 16 select RTL8192C_COMMON
6f334c2b
LF
17 select RTLWIFI
18 select RTLWIFI_PCI
0c817338
LF
19 ---help---
20 This is the driver for Realtek RTL8192CE/RTL8188CE 802.11n PCIe
21 wireless network adapters.
22
18db45c4 23 If you choose to build it as a module, it will be called rtl8192ce
0c817338 24
85e09b40
CL
25config RTL8192SE
26 tristate "Realtek RTL8192SE/RTL8191SE PCIe Wireless Network Adapter"
6f334c2b
LF
27 depends on PCI
28 select RTLWIFI
29 select RTLWIFI_PCI
85e09b40
CL
30 ---help---
31 This is the driver for Realtek RTL8192SE/RTL8191SE 802.11n PCIe
32 wireless network adapters.
33
34 If you choose to build it as a module, it will be called rtl8192se
35
f9fc5136
CL
36config RTL8192DE
37 tristate "Realtek RTL8192DE/RTL8188DE PCIe Wireless Network Adapter"
6f334c2b
LF
38 depends on PCI
39 select RTLWIFI
40 select RTLWIFI_PCI
f9fc5136
CL
41 ---help---
42 This is the driver for Realtek RTL8192DE/RTL8188DE 802.11n PCIe
43 wireless network adapters.
44
45 If you choose to build it as a module, it will be called rtl8192de
46
a2905935
LF
47config RTL8723AE
48 tristate "Realtek RTL8723AE PCIe Wireless Network Adapter"
6f334c2b
LF
49 depends on PCI
50 select RTLWIFI
51 select RTLWIFI_PCI
0a168b48 52 select RTL8723_COMMON
aa45a673 53 select RTLBTCOEXIST
a2905935
LF
54 ---help---
55 This is the driver for Realtek RTL8723AE 802.11n PCIe
56 wireless network adapters.
57
58 If you choose to build it as a module, it will be called rtl8723ae
59
a619d1ab
LF
60config RTL8723BE
61 tristate "Realtek RTL8723BE PCIe Wireless Network Adapter"
62 depends on PCI
63 select RTLWIFI
64 select RTLWIFI_PCI
65 select RTL8723_COMMON
66 select RTLBTCOEXIST
67 ---help---
68 This is the driver for Realtek RTL8723BE 802.11n PCIe
69 wireless network adapters.
70
71 If you choose to build it as a module, it will be called rtl8723be
72
8b138d48
LF
73config RTL8188EE
74 tristate "Realtek RTL8188EE Wireless Network Adapter"
6f334c2b
LF
75 depends on PCI
76 select RTLWIFI
77 select RTLWIFI_PCI
8b138d48
LF
78 ---help---
79 This is the driver for Realtek RTL8188EE 802.11n PCIe
80 wireless network adapters.
81
82 If you choose to build it as a module, it will be called rtl8188ee
83
b1a3bfc9
LF
84config RTL8192EE
85 tristate "Realtek RTL8192EE Wireless Network Adapter"
86 depends on PCI
87 select RTLWIFI
88 select RTLWIFI_PCI
989377e1 89 select RTLBTCOEXIST
b1a3bfc9
LF
90 ---help---
91 This is the driver for Realtek RTL8192EE 802.11n PCIe
92 wireless network adapters.
93
94 If you choose to build it as a module, it will be called rtl8192ee
95
21e4b072
LF
96config RTL8821AE
97 tristate "Realtek RTL8821AE/RTL8812AE Wireless Network Adapter"
98 depends on PCI
99 select RTLWIFI
100 select RTLWIFI_PCI
574a7930 101 select RTLBTCOEXIST
21e4b072 102 ---help---
7b457dd0 103 This is the driver for Realtek RTL8821AE/RTL8812AE 802.11ac PCIe
21e4b072
LF
104 wireless network adapters.
105
106 If you choose to build it as a module, it will be called rtl8821ae
107
663dcc73
LF
108config RTL8192CU
109 tristate "Realtek RTL8192CU/RTL8188CU USB Wireless Network Adapter"
6f334c2b
LF
110 depends on USB
111 select RTLWIFI
112 select RTLWIFI_USB
1472d3a8 113 select RTL8192C_COMMON
663dcc73
LF
114 ---help---
115 This is the driver for Realtek RTL8192CU/RTL8188CU 802.11n USB
116 wireless network adapters.
117
118 If you choose to build it as a module, it will be called rtl8192cu
119
6f334c2b
LF
120config RTLWIFI
121 tristate
122 select FW_LOADER
123
124config RTLWIFI_PCI
125 tristate
126
127config RTLWIFI_USB
128 tristate
129
130config RTLWIFI_DEBUG
131 bool "Debugging output for rtlwifi driver family"
132 depends on RTLWIFI
133 default y
134 ---help---
135 To use the module option that sets the dynamic-debugging level for,
136 the front-end driver, this parameter must be "Y". For memory-limited
137 systems, choose "N". If in doubt, choose "Y".
138
1472d3a8
LF
139config RTL8192C_COMMON
140 tristate
f9fc5136 141 depends on RTL8192CE || RTL8192CU
6f334c2b
LF
142 default y
143
0a168b48
LF
144config RTL8723_COMMON
145 tristate
a619d1ab 146 depends on RTL8723AE || RTL8723BE
0a168b48
LF
147 default y
148
aa45a673
LF
149config RTLBTCOEXIST
150 tristate
989377e1 151 depends on RTL8723AE || RTL8723BE || RTL8821AE || RTL8192EE
aa45a673
LF
152 default y
153
6f334c2b 154endif
This page took 0.384233 seconds and 5 git commands to generate.